Thanks Mike. I got the Sync Shift, one step down from the reverser tranny, and am really enjoying it. I will not elaborate on that as the hydro vs. gear topic already gets plenty of attention. Having power steering, live pto, shift on the go,and a loader is like night and day for me compared to the old Ford 2000. I do have to be more careful on the steep grades as the 4310 is not a stable as the Ford. My only problems are some bounce in the fuel gauge and the instrument panel started fogging up today. I will talk to my dealer next week about that. I might ask him to just supply me the parts and I'll put in a new fuel sender and the antifog glass kit myself when I do my 50 hour service. That will give me an excuse to buy the service manual for it now instead of after the warranty expires.

Thanks for the info on the fuel gauge. If it just bounces and remains fairly accurate I will leave it alone.

Shari, I don't know the gauge of the expanded metal but it is the heavy stuff. It was a scrap I bought from a local wrecking yard for $8.00. It's welded to 1/2" square stock that was heated, bent to curve around the radiused top and welded to the inside of the factory guard. The finished unit is turned in the opposite direction from the factory mounting orientation. Grainger or McMaster-Carr, I can't remember which, sell several varieties of expanded metal sheet in 2X2. I think it runs about $15.00 plus shipping. They both have pretty good web sites. Now if it will just dry up so I can get back to mowing. Rained off and on all night.
